Shanghai's 高端茶会所 (high-end tea clubs) represent the premium segment of the city's tea culture, offering sophisticated environments and exceptional tea experiences. These establishments cater to discerning clients who seek both quality tea and refined social settings.
The operational characteristics of these elite venues demonstrate several distinctive features. They maintain extensive collections of 名贵茶叶 (premium teas), often including rare vintages of 老普洱茶 (aged Pu'er) and competition-grade 武夷岩茶 (Wuyi rock teas). The service is provided by highly trained 茶艺专家 (tea specialists) who possess deep knowledge of tea brewing techniques and tea culture. The venues feature 豪华装修 (luxury interiors) that blend traditional Chinese aesthetics with contemporary comfort, creating spaces suitable for both business entertainment and personal tea appreciation.

These tea clubs typically implement strict 会员制度 (membership systems) that ensure privacy and exclusivity. Many require referrals from existing members and maintain limited membership numbers to preserve the quality of service. The membership benefits often include priority access to rare tea releases, private tasting events with tea masters, and customized tea storage services.
The pricing structure reflects the exclusive nature of these establishments. Individual tea sessions generally range from 800 to 2,000 RMB per person, while annual membership fees typically fall between 20,000 and 100,000 RMB, depending on the level of privileges. Special tea tasting events featuring renowned tea masters or rare tea collections can command significantly higher prices.
The clientele primarily consists of successful 企业主 (business owners), senior 公司高管 (corporate executives), serious 茶叶收藏家 (tea collectors), and distinguished 外国客人 (international guests). These patrons value not only the quality of tea but also the discreet atmosphere and networking opportunities these venues provide.
Recent trends in this sector show interesting developments. There's growing demand for 茶文化教育 (tea culture education) programs within these clubs, with members seeking deeper understanding of tea appreciation and collection. Many clubs have expanded their services to include 茶叶投资咨询 (tea investment consulting) and professional tea storage solutions. The integration of modern technology for tea preservation and brewing precision has also become increasingly common.
